Private ADHD Adult Assessment: Understanding the Process and Benefits

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is frequently viewed as a youth condition, however it affects numerous adults also. For those who suspect they may have ADHD, getting an extensive and private assessment can be a crucial step towards understanding and managing their signs. This article checks out the elements surrounding private ADHD adult assessments, what they entail, their value, and the potential advantages they use.

What is an ADHD Assessment?

An ADHD assessment usually includes a comprehensive examination by a certified professional to figure out if a specific fulfills the requirements for ADHD. The private nature of such assessments enables a more personalized method, frequently leading to higher comfort and candor throughout the evaluation procedure.

Key Components of an ADHD Assessment

  1. Clinical Interview: This includes detailed questioning about the person's individual, medical, and family history. The clinician may ask about specific ADHD symptoms and how they affect everyday life.
  2. Self-Assessment Questionnaires: Individuals might be asked to finish standardized ADHD questionnaires to recognize symptoms and patterns of behavior.
  3. Behavioral Observations: The clinician might observe the individual in numerous settings to examine their behaviors in real time.
  4. Security Information: Gathering info from relative, partners, or coworkers can provide additional context relating to the person's habits and difficulties.

Preparing for a Private ADHD Assessment

Preparation can considerably enhance the effectiveness of an ADHD assessment. Here are some actions people can take:

  • Self-Reflect: Consider daily difficulties, behavioral patterns, and previous experiences. Journaling symptoms can be especially handy.
  • Collect Documentation: Bring any pertinent medical records, in addition to info regarding past treatments or assessments.
  • Invite Input: If comfy, bring a family member or partner who can supply extra insight into behaviors.
  • Be Honest: Transparency is crucial in revealing symptoms, challenges, and the influence on day-to-day life for a precise assessment.
